Harrah Story Time offers a delightful morning for young children and their caregivers to connect through the magic of literature. Held at the Swan Memorial Harrah Library, this session features a curated selection of stories, interactive songs, rhythmic fingerplays, and engaging activities designed to foster early literacy skills. It is a perfect opportunity for families to socialize and introduce their little ones to the joy of reading in a welcoming, community-focused environment.
What to Expect
A lively, hour-long session filled with age-appropriate stories and songs led by library staff.
